Summary: | With the development of ICT technology, various technologies that can improve players' performance in the sports field are being developed. In particular, immersive technology can be implemented in virtual space for various situations that are difficult to implement without space-time constraints. In this paper, we propose MR-based outdoor training system to improve football player performance. This proposed system is developed via Unity3D and MRTK and designed suitable for Microsoft HoloLens 2. This system allows users to switch freely and facilitates iterative analysis and prediction. We expect that this system can improve the user's performance to analyze the situation. |
